Noel EdisonAbout
Noel Edison admits that such an album tackling the extensive realm of folk song can only ever be “a brief snapshot of somte of the conductors’ favourite pieces.” His particular focus was to select mainly Canadian arrangements as the ensemble’s country had just celebrated its sesquicentennial anniversary. “There are a good number of Canadian songs here from coast to coast from local lore. England has a rich treasure trove of folk songs and I could not complete this compilation without including a few that I love. Finally, and maybe the odd choice, Billy Joel’s And so it goes”; an American classic has always touched the conductor personally.
The Elora Singers, formerly known as the Elora Festival Singers, founded in 1980 by artistic director Noel Edison, is an all-professional Grammy- and twice Juno-nominated chamber choir known for its rich, warm sound and clarity of texture. The Elora Singers is also renowned for its commitment to Canadian repertoire and for its collaborations with other artists from across Canada and around the world. Through its regular concert series, recordings, broadcasts and touring, the Elora Singers is widely praised as one of the finest chamber choirs in Canada, contributing to the musical life of our local communities throughout the country as well as on the international stage. The choir is the principal choral ensemble of the Elora Festival and, since 1997, has been the professional core of the Toronto Mendelssohn Choir.
